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03 91605567 18546 7840605 2132779
373508 6757727325
373508 6757727325
13614060125 314047 1927335 75846177237
All about undefined
Interested in learning more?
373508 6757727325
13614060125 314047 1927335 75846177237
See more
2229 70
1417988 75773613738 421280 07
See more
567231 09206115 26
37 633 80160
See more